Liudmila Samsonova - A Brief Life Story
Liudmila Dmitrievna Samsonova, a professional tennis player from Russia, came into the world on November 11, 1998. She is, as a matter of fact, 26 years old at the moment, which is a pretty good age for a tennis player who is making her mark. Her beginnings were in Olenegorsk, an industrial city in Russia's Murmansk Oblast. Personal Details and Bio Data
Detail | Information |
---|---|
Full Name | Liudmila Dmitrievna Samsonova |
Nationality | Russian |
Date of Birth | November 11, 1998 |
Age | 26 years (as of current time) |
Birthplace | Olenegorsk, Murmansk Oblast, Russia |
Father's Name | Dmitry (involved in table tennis) |
Plays | Professional Tennis |
Tour | WTA International Tennis Tour |

What Are Samsonova's Career Achievements and Their Impact on Her Ranking?
Liudmila Samsonova has, as a matter of fact, collected five career titles, which is a really good achievement for any professional tennis player. Each one of these wins contributes points towards her ranking, helping her move up the list. Winning a title means she beat every opponent in that particular event, showing a sustained level of high-quality play throughout the week. These victories are concrete proof of her ability to perform under pressure and close out matches, which is essential for a good Samsonova ranking.
Beyond titles, reaching later stages in major tournaments also plays a big part. Her first time making it to the round of 16 at Roland Garros, for instance, is a significant milestone. Grand Slams offer the most ranking points, so doing well in these big events can cause a substantial rise in a player's position. This kind of performance shows she can compete with the very best on the biggest stages, which is crucial for a strong Samsonova ranking. Samsonova Ranking and Her Financial Gains
It's pretty clear that a player's ranking and their financial earnings are very much connected in professional tennis. The better a player does, and the higher they climb on the ranking list, the more prize money they tend to take home. Liudmila Samsonova's career earnings, which stand at $5,246,528, are a direct reflection of her success on the court. This figure includes money from tournament wins, reaching certain rounds, and other bonuses tied to performance, you know. It’s a good indicator of her overall impact in the sport.
Every match won, every round advanced, and every title claimed adds to a player's financial total. A higher Samsonova ranking means she gets into bigger tournaments with larger prize pools, and often gets better seeding, which can lead to deeper runs and more money. It’s a bit of a cycle: good play leads to a better ranking, which leads to more opportunities and greater financial rewards. Where Can We Find More About Samsonova's Ranking and Stats?
For fans who want to keep a close eye on Liudmila Samsonova's career, there are several reliable places to find information about her ranking and other important statistics. Websites like ESPN.com offer the latest news, stats, and videos about her, which is really helpful. These platforms usually have player profiles that are updated regularly, giving you a quick way to see how she's doing, you know.
The official Women's Tennis Association (WTA) website is another excellent resource. It provides player stats, videos, highlights, and more directly from the source. This is where you'll find the most accurate and up-to-date information on her current Samsonova ranking, her match history, and other details about her performance. It’s pretty much the go-to spot for official tennis data, actually.
Other sports information sites, like Flashscore.com, also offer detailed statistics such as live scores, final and partial results, draws, match history point by point, and records per season and surface. This kind of depth is fantastic for anyone who wants to really dig into her performance data. You can also find her player profile, rankings, and statistics on tennis.com, which gives you another good spot to keep up with her Samsonova ranking and overall play.
